1. A computerized method for selecting a provider that provides a radio communication service that can be received by a mobile station via a radio access network and is provided by a plurality of service providers via the radio access network, the method comprising:

  • receiving from the mobile station via a radio interface of the radio access network a request to select a provider for the service from the plurality of service providers by a selecting device;

    requesting the plurality of service providers to indicate a value of a selection parameter by the selecting device;

    selecting the provider by the selecting device based on the values received from the indication request, the plurality of service providers indicating respective values within a first time interval and the selecting of the provider occurring after a second time interval, wherein after the first time interval comparing the values received with each other to perform an initial selecting of a provider based on a most favorable value from the values received, and re-requesting at least a portion of the plurality of service providers to indicate a new value of the selection parameter, wherein in the event the received new values of at least two providers have an identical value, the selecting by the selecting device is performed on a random basis; and

    notifying said portion of the service providers of the most favorable value from the values received so that at least one of said service providers can provide a new value chosen to undercut the most favorable value;

    wherein, in the event the received new values of at least two service providers have identical values, said at least two service providers is each notified of the existence of said identical values so that at least one of said at least two service providers can change its own identical value to pre-empt a random selection.
